Mission

The Emerge School for Autism offers a specialized therapeutic educational model designed to foster development in Autistic children with high support needs. Our school is a safe, accepting environment that promotes active learning and independence, preparing each child to function, learn, and thrive in a less restrictive school setting.

Our School

The Emerge School for Autism was born from the demand of extended educational services for children with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D). We are excited to provide this unique therapeutically-focused education option to families in our community as the first tuition-free school for children with ASD in the state of Louisiana.
